Day 1: Coffee Farm | Maya Museum

You will be met at your hotel this morning by your private guide for today's excursion. First, transfer to the village of Jocotenango, just on the outskirts of Antigua, where you can visit the local workshops of the traditional woodcarvers of the area. You can also see the interesting pink and white facade of the Jocotenango church before you transfer across to the wonderful Azotea Coffee farm and museums. Here you can have a private guided tour of the Coffee Farm and the museums exhibiting traditional Mayan music and costumes. Learn about the importance of coffee in Guatemala's history and its impact today, while hearing about the Maya way of life.

This tour is approximately 3-4 hours with a private guide.
